16 Activating Calibration Reset Mode: - 703 Series Different altitudes will cause water to boil at different temperatures. To prevent the water in the boiling water tank from boiling continuously (which is energy inefficient) the boiling water unit is fitted with an altitude calibration function whi...

23 ELECTRICAL REQUIREMENTS WARNING • 220 – 240 Volts AC, 50 Hz, Single Phase • 7.5 Amps on 3 Litre • 10 Amps on 5, 7.5,10 & 15 litre models • 15 Amps on 25 litre model • 20 Amps on 40 litre model A flexible cord is supplied on all 3, 5, 7.5, 10 and 15 Litre models. Do not loosen the cord grip or...
